Originally posted by Hopper:Originally posted by strickac:NT: We need a NT bad, IMO. Sopoaga gets no push in the middle. We need someone that can collapse the pocket on occasion.
FS/CB: More talent in the secondary would be nice. Carlos needs to get an extension. Goldson will possibly price himself out of our price range. With Fangio's aggressive style, he'll be looking for athletic playmakers in the secondary, similar to the Packers D.
WR: Ginn is a Returner, not a WR. We could use some more talent there. I expect Braylon to have a big impact when he returns, but I'm skeptical that the team resigns him. Crabs and Morgan are solid #2s, IMO. Williams needs to stay healthy and get on the field. He has some nice speed and good hands. We lack depth and speed at the position.
OLB: Fangio likes pass rushers and we're seeing Haralson less and less. There's not much depth behind Brooks and Aldon. We could really use another pass rusher to add to the rotation.
RB: Dixon doesn't seem to fit in with the longterm plan. I think the team will look for another guy to fall to the mid-late rounds.

Run D hasn't been a problem for years, mainly because we've had such a lack of pass rushers. If our defense lacks anything, it's the ability to stop great passing teams. If we had a NT that was able to generate pressure, than it just makes things that much easier for the OLBs and in turn, the secondary. When I watch Sopoaga on pass plays, he usually stands straight up at the snap and plays pattycake with the OC/OG. He just stands his ground and waits/hopes for the play to come to him. He's better than that, but I just don't see it in the passing game. I have no complaints with his run D.
